Hi all,
when I first put the map up I also included a note with directions on how to locate a lair if you had the number, but it seems to have become separated from the map. So here it is again ....

As garngad rightly says, if you can locate a nearby War Grave, and it's number, then the direction the row is numbered it's quite easy to get close to the lair you're looking for. Another method I use, if you find a stone which is numbered, as in photo above, I work on the theory it's 'one pace' between lairs. So start at say 721, count 43 paces and you should be 'very' close to 764.

If all else fails, as already stated, the groundsmen are normally around during the week and are extremely helpful.
